B. Jonathan B. Jonathan wrote: > > Hi there, I have following equations to be solved for a and b: > > a/(a+b) = x1 > ab/((a+b)^2 (a+b+1)) = x2 > > Is there any direct function available to solve them without > disentangling them manually? Thanks for your help. >
There is a package nleqslv that will solve a system of equations with either a Newton or Broyden method. You can do this library(nleqslv) # trial values x1 <- .6 x2 <- .2 eqn <- function(par) { a <- par[1] b <- par[2] f <- numeric(2) f[1] <- a/(a+b) - x1 f[2] <- a*b/((a+b)^2 * (a+b+1)) - x2 f } pstart <- c(1,1) nleqslv(pstart,eqn,control=list(trace=1)) #or this if you don't need the trace nleqslv(pstart,eqn) There is also a package BB that uses different methods and is especially geared towards very large systems.
